Shearman & Sterling advised Cooperativa Muratori & Cementisti-C.M.C. di Ravenna Società Cooperativa (CMC) on its €250 million high yield bond offering.
The €250 million senior notes mature in 2022 and have a fixed coupon of 6.875%. The notes are listed on the Official List of the Luxembourg Stock Exchange and traded on the Luxembourg Stock Exchange’s Euro MTF market.
CMC is an international construction company headquartered in Italy. It constructs transport infrastructure networks including roads, motorways, tunnels, bridges, viaducts, railways, undergrounds, and airports.
